A total upheaval of its program schedule due to confinement. As of Monday 23 March, France 4 modifies all of its daytime programming to broadcast live lessons given by National Education teachers to meet the "Learning Nation" mission, announced the France Télévisions group in a press release. press sent to newsrooms.

The chain will thus offer lessons given by teachers for all school children from Monday to Friday.

The course schedule

  • 9h - 10h for CP - CE1: 30 min of reading - 30 min of math
  • 11h - 12h the Lumni house for 8-12 years old and more specifically for CM1 - CM2
  • 2 p.m. - 3 p.m. for college students: 30 min of French - 30 min of math
  • 3 p.m. - 4 p.m. for high school students (especially the first and final years): 1 hour of French, Maths, Histoire-Géo, Anglais or Philo

Historical documentaries

The channel will also broadcast on Tuesday evening in prime time for middle school and high school students "Entrée en matters", a new box of historical documentaries.

The rest of the day and weekends, priority will be given to a fun educational program that will alternate content for school use, with more entertaining programs. These new educational offers from France Televisions will also be brought to all overseas audiences.

Lumni, the educational platform for all of the public audiovisual sector, Okoo, the entertaining platform for children and France TV Slash, the digital offer dedicated to young adults, will also allow the youngest to stay at home without bother.
